PRO LX7 Bookshelf Speaker (400-4063) Features Faxback Doc. # 32907 Your PRO LX7 Bookshelf Speaker's internal elements were exclusively designed to maintain shape through all phases of operation, move diaphragm elements with efficient speed, and faithfully reproduce high frequencies. The 7-inch driver is specially designed to accurately produce all sonic information from 55 Hz to 2 kHz. The pliable diaphragm in the 3-inch x 3 1/2-inch driver can accurately produce sonic information from 2 kHz to 25 kHz with extraordinarily low distortion. The tweeter's unique design means there is virtually no physical limitation to its production of high frequency sound. The speaker cabinet is finished in black woodgrain vinyl. The dark gray cloth grille is acoustically transparent, and you can remove it for safe and easy cleaning. This speaker gives you amazing music reproduction in a small enclosure. It produces high sound quality with very low distortion, and actually delivers decreasing distortion as the sound moves to the higher frequency ranges. Its features include: Optimus True Line Source Driver - uses a pliable diaphragm to reduce or eliminate distortion caused by excess vibration. It also can reproduce higher frequencies (over 20 kHz) without being limited by its physical construction. High-Compliance Woofer - accurately tracks signals to provide outstanding bass. Acoustic Design - provides broad, smooth frequency response. SPEAKER PLACEMENT For the best stereo image, place a pair of speakers so the distance between them is about the same as the distance between the listening area and the point halfway between the speakers. If you must place the speakers farther apart, turn them slightly inward. If you must place them closer to each other, turn them slightly outward. Experiment with your speaker's placement to discover the best location for them. (BR/EB 5/6/96)
